Transaction 04783a1f165852e1894a2c077da8b76856ae41623801de32601823967ab086b3

4 Input
2 Outputs
  • 04783a1f165852e1894a2c077da8b76856ae41623801de32601823967ab086b3:0
  • value  1245254
    address  1EUMRZEk4hcX6eHA9w7mjJZXRrMuLBUCyV
  • 04783a1f165852e1894a2c077da8b76856ae41623801de32601823967ab086b3:1
  • value  10500000
    address  11yroijDy1xdy5dThNuJxm6XMt87NCnyu